I think we really need to give Sarah Michelle Gellar a break.
I remember from day 1, she was always the one promoting Buffy the vampire slayer. When it was still a new show on the WB, SMG would do magazine covers, interviews, autograph signings to not only promote BTVS, but to also promote the WB at the time. She was trying very hard to get the word out about the WB and it's shows. The president of the WB Network at the time even gave her the title "The Queen of the WB", when all her work finally paid off in Season 2 and the show became a huge hit, helping other WB shows like "7th Heaven" and "Dawson's Creek" take off.
Sarah Michelle Gellar didn't even ASK for a raise when the show became popular. The WB gave it to her and said that she deserved it. Even though everyone on the show was signed on for 5 seasons, SMG's contract expired in 1999 (after Season 3). SMG could've easily decided to leave the show then and move on to do movies because it seemed like they were working for her (I Know What You Did Last Summer, Cruel Intentions), but she renewed her contract through 2002. That was a huge commitment. If she really hated playing Buffy then she would've never renewed her contract.
